26/48 Moondine Drive, Wembley

Perched quietly in the corner where peace and privacy reign supreme, this fully renovated ground floor apartment is a highly sought-after residence. Located at the end of a secure gated complex and directly opposite the tranquil Moondine Park, it offers a lifestyle defined by serenity and convenience. The open plan living area flows seamlessly to a private courtyard, ideal for relaxed entertaining or quiet evenings.

The home features two bedrooms and one bathroom, with a kitchen, dining and living area, laundry, and an additional WC. Built approximately in 1993, the apartment has been stylishly renovated throughout, including a feature leadlight entry door, fresh paint, and new carpets in the bedrooms and living areas.

The kitchen is tiled and functional, equipped with stylish light fittings, overhead and under-bench storage cupboards, a breakfast bar, glass splashbacks, a Dishlex dishwasher, and a 900mm wide integrated range hood with stainless steel IAG five burner gas cooktop and under-bench oven appliances. The European-style laundry includes ample power points, a wash trough, and under-bench storage, integrated into the floor plan.

The front second bedroom is light, bright, and generous in size, featuring a remote-controlled ceiling fan and ample power points, along with a linen press for storage. The large rear main bedroom suite includes a remote ceiling fan, a walk-through wardrobe leading to a separate WC, and a sleek semi-ensuite bathroom with a shower, separate bathtub, powder vanity, and under-bench storage.

The comfortable open plan living and dining area is enhanced by a Daikin split system air conditioner, a gas bayonet for heating, and modern feature lighting. Manual security window roller shutters provide peace of mind, complemented by ceiling cornices, skirting boards, a front security door, external power points, and a gas hot water system.

Outside, the spacious paved rear courtyard offers a covered alfresco entertaining area with an eastern aspect that captures the morning sun. The low-maintenance reticulated citrus garden and clothesline/drying space add to the outdoor appeal. Both the living area and main bedroom have direct access to the courtyard.

The complex features a common central swimming pool with protective shade sails and a poolside courtyard for residents and guests to relax. Gated side access from the courtyard leads to a common drying area with multiple clotheslines for additional hanging space.

Parking includes a pitched single carport located just meters from the front door, securely nestled behind a remote-controlled driveway access gate. A separate pin code pedestrian gate provides easy and secure access to the complex. On-site visitor parking bays and additional parking options across the road alongside Moondine Park are available. The apartment also includes a lock-up storeroom.

Located in the secure "Parkside" complex, residents enjoy proximity to beautiful Moondine Park and the birdlife of picturesque Herdsman Lake, offering a daily retreat into nature. Lakeside walking trails, fresh food at The Herdsman, bus stops, local cafes, restaurants, and the Herdsman Lake Tavern are all within walking distance. Glendalough Train Station and the freeway are nearby, along with local shopping villages, top public and private schools, the coast, Lake Monger, and vibrant Perth CBD.

This apartment represents a unique lifestyle opportunity combining privacy, convenience, and natural beauty.

Title Details: Lot 26 on Strata Plan 24719, Volume 1967 Folio 226.

Strata Information: Exclusive use car bay, storeroom, and courtyard. The apartment has 81 square meters internally. The complex comprises 43 apartments.

Estimated Rental Return: $650 - $690 per week.

Outgoings: City of Stirling: $1,696.28 per annum; Water Corporation: $1,182.36 per annum; Strata Levy: $766.51 per quarter; Reserve Levy: $157.50 per quarter; Total Strata Levies: $924.01 per quarter.
